CEAT 195: Dreamweaver CS3 Level I
3.00 Credits
Tompkins Cortland Community College
Learn the latest Web site building techniques using the powerful Adobe Dreamweaver CS3 interface. In Level I you will create documents, incorporate text and images, manage files and folders, prepare metadata, and connect content with links. You will also explore the current strategies for organizing the structure of information and controlling its format. Gain competency with Cascading Style sheets (CSS) as you build an external CSS file to manage page properties, content margins and padding, and typography settings, as well as working with more advanced CSS selectors such as class and ID. In each of these activities you will discover how Dreamweaver CS3 simplifies tasks with its well crafted user controls. No previous knowledge of HTML required.

CEAT 196: Dreamweaver CS3 Level II
3.00 Credits
Tompkins Cortland Community College
Expand your existing knowledge of Adobe Dreamweaver CS3 and learn advanced page layout and enhanced interactivity techniques. You will build and modify tables and apply format to table elements. You will construct page layouts using state of the art methods. Collecting information from web visitors is an important component of successful web sites. You will build a form, add form elements, and format the form using a style sheet. You will also explore the Code View option to gain familiarity with XHTML and make minor edits to the document. With Dreamweaver's prebuilt behaviors, you will add user interactivity such as roll over images, opening browser windows, and general form validation. Prerequisite: Dreamweaver CS3 Level I or equivalent

CEAT 197: Dreamweaver CS3 Level III
3.00 Credits
Tompkins Cortland Community College
Gain advanced Web site development skills in this third workshop in a series on Adobe Dreamweaver CS3. You will create page templates, modify the editable regions, establish optional content regions, and create web pages from your template. You will also explore features that improve efficiency such as task automation and the powerful find and replace tool. Using XML and Ajax, Dreamweaver CS3 Spry tools simplify building dynamic content such as pop-up menus, expandable display panes, and advanced form field validation. You will also learn how to use Dreamweaver file management features to set up a remote site, select recently modified pages, and transfer pages to and from the remote site. Prerequisite: Dreamweaver CS3 Level I and II or equivalent
